#911822 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#911822 is composed of 56.9% red, 9.4%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.4% magenta, 76.6%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 355 degrees, a saturation of 71.6% and a lightness of 33.1%. #911822 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3044 with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#911822 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#911822 has RGB values of R:145, G:24,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.77,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 9508898.
